The article deals with the resonant mechanism of the generation of terahertz radiation based on the interaction between a laser pulse and two-level quantum particles with a permanent dipole moment. In the case when the permanent dipole moment exceeds the transition dipole moment, the resonant mechanism is more efficient compared to the nonresonant optical rectification.
